Job Description:

 

The Role:

Join SiFive's tools team to develop and maintain the core tools and flows required for microprocessor design. Work on simulation and build tools to validate microprocessor designs, as well as the infrastructure around those flows.  An ideal candidate will have systems-level programming experience; have built complex systems with multiple tools communicating through multiple means such as files, pipes, shared memory, databases, and REST calls; and have a strong desire to produce correct and tested tools.

Requirements:

  • Systems programming experience.

  • Fluency in C++ and Python.

  • Fluency with standard Linux-based development environments and tools.

  • Experience with build tools and languages, including make and cmake.

  • Test and verification methodologies for software tools.

Desired:

  • Above-average knowledge of processor microarchitecture.

  • Detailed profiling experience.

  • Experience with simulation and emulation tools, especially development of them  (e.g. QEMU, etc).

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
